information entity > scientific discourse > testable hypothesis > environmental support hypothesis

Término preferido

environmental support hypothesis  

Notice: Undefined index: in /var/www/html/model/Concept.php on line 545

Definición

  • A testable hypothesis stating that older adults have more difficulty spontaneously initiating processing operations than younger adults, which affects their memory performance, but that external information present in the environment can help them compensate for these difficulties.
